Background
The common kitchen garbage disposal equipment in the market at present has two kinds, one is monomer formula garbage disposer, and two biological garbage disposers, however, both have some shortcomings in the use of two kinds of garbage disposers, for example:
1. single garbage disposer: kitchen waste forms centrifugal force in the cavity through high-speed motor, drives the blade disc and cuts, smashes, grinds the food waste who pours into, in smashing grinding treatment back and water mixing becomes liquid form and directly discharges into the sewer, causes secondary pollution to the water resource, and causes the jam of sewer pipe easily.
2. Biological garbage disposer: the drainage treatment device for the whole building needs a special drainage system to prevent the pipeline from being blocked, the drainage system of the building is firstly degraded by microorganisms and then drained into the public drainage system, but the maintenance of the drainage system means that each household bears higher property cost. And from the perspective of sewage treatment plants, if households discharge scattered food into a sewage pipe by using the garbage disposer, the amount of sludge is increased, and the workload is increased.

Examples
Referring to fig. 1-7, the present invention provides the following technical solutions: the utility model provides a multi-functional surplus garbage disposer in kitchen, including kitchen stainless steel basin 1 and rubbing crusher 2, kitchen stainless steel basin 1's bottom is connected with rubbing crusher 2, one side of kitchen stainless steel basin 1 is equipped with treater body 3, rubbing crusher 2 passes through the pipe connection with treater body 3, treater body 3 includes casing 4, solid-liquid separation device 5, purifier 6 and reaction vessel 7, wherein, the inside upper end of casing 4 is connected with solid-liquid separation device 5, reaction vessel 7 is connected to solid-liquid separation device 5's below, one side of reaction vessel 7 is connected with purifier 6.
Further, the solid-liquid separation device 5 comprises a separation bin base 51, a scraper frame 52, a solid-liquid separation bin 53, a solid outlet 54, a scraper motor 55, an inlet pipe 56, a liquid outlet pipe 57, a solid-liquid separation filter screen 58, scrapers 59 and an upper cover plate 510, wherein the solid-liquid separation bin 53 is placed inside the separation bin base 51, the solid-liquid separation filter screen 58 is connected to the bottom of the solid-liquid separation bin 53, a gap is formed between the solid-liquid separation filter screen 58 and the bottom of the separation bin base 51, the scraper motor 55 is connected to the position of the center of the circle of the solid-liquid separation filter screen 58, the scraper frame 52 is connected to the output end of the scraper motor 55, scrapers 59 are connected to both ends of the scraper frame 52, the solid outlet 54 is arranged at the corresponding positions on the solid-liquid separation filter screen 58 and the separation bin base 51, the inlet pipe 56 and the liquid, the opening of the liquid outlet pipe 57 is positioned at the gap between the solid-liquid separation filter screen 58 and the separation bin base 51, the inlet pipe 56 is connected with the pulverizer 2, the liquid outlet pipe 57 is connected with a sewer, and the upper cover plate 510 is arranged above the separation bin base 51.
By adopting the technical scheme, the solid-liquid separation is carried out on the kitchen garbage.
Further, the reaction barrel 7 comprises a stirring barrel 71, a stirring shaft 72, a stirring rod 73, a stirring barrel filter screen 74, a stirring motor 75, a small chain wheel 76, a chain 77, a large chain wheel 78, a stirring blade 79 and an exhaust port 710, wherein the stirring barrel 71 is located below the solid outlet 54, the stirring shaft 72 is rotatably connected inside the stirring barrel 71, the stirring rod 73 and the stirring blade 79 are respectively connected to the stirring shaft 72, the stirring rod 73 is located on one side of the stirring blade 79, the stirring motor 75 is connected to one side of the stirring barrel 71, the small chain wheel 76 is connected to the output end of the stirring motor 75, one end of the stirring shaft 72 is connected with the large chain wheel 78 corresponding to the small chain wheel 76, the large chain wheel 78 and the small chain wheel 76 are in transmission connection through the chain 77, the exhaust port 710 is arranged on the side wall of the stirring barrel 71, and the stirring barrel filter.
By adopting the technical scheme, the solid kitchen garbage is biologically fermented into the organic fertilizer through the reaction barrel 7.
Further, the purification device 6 comprises a fan 61, a middle pipe 62 and a large pipe 63, wherein the fan 61 is connected with the middle pipe 62, the middle pipe 62 is connected with the large pipe 63, and the large pipe 63 is connected with the exhaust port 710.
Through adopting above-mentioned technical scheme, purify the peculiar smell that produces and the gas of harmful substance through purifier 6 to the fermentation.
Further, the middle tube 62 comprises a middle tube upper cover 621, an overheat protector 622, a middle tube heating pipe 623 and a middle tube lower cover 624, wherein the bottom of the middle tube 62 is connected with the middle tube lower cover 624, the middle tube 62 is connected with the middle tube heating pipe 623, the middle tube 62 is connected with the middle tube upper cover 621 above, and the overheat protector 622 is connected with the middle tube upper cover 621 above.
Through adopting above-mentioned technical scheme, disinfect, deodorization and dehumidification through well pipe 62 to the peculiar smell that the fermentation produced and the gas of harmful substance.
Further, the large pipe 63 comprises a large pipe lower cover 631, a UV germicidal lamp 632 and a large pipe upper cover 633, wherein the large pipe lower cover 631 is connected to the bottom of the large pipe 63, the UV germicidal lamp 632 is connected to the inside of the large pipe 63, and the large pipe upper cover 633 is connected to the upper side of the large pipe 63.
Through adopting above-mentioned technical scheme, disinfect the disinfection through the gas of peculiar smell and harmful substance that the big pipe 63 produced the fermentation.
Further, an aluminum foil heating plate 8 is connected to the bottom of the reaction barrel 7.
By adopting the technical scheme, a proper activity environment is created for decomposing organic matters by microorganisms through heating.
Furthermore, a key board 9 is connected to one side surface above the casing 4, a controller is connected to the inside of the casing 4, and the solid-liquid separation device 5, the purification device 6, the reaction barrel 7 and the aluminum foil heating sheet 8 are respectively connected to the key board 9 and the controller.
The model of the pulverizer 2 in this embodiment is ZJ-370A, sold by Enlishu; the scraper motor 55 is a 60-type synchronous motor, and is sold by Union motor manufacturers; the model of the fan 61 is 0850, and the fan is sold by a constant-gain motor manufacturer; the model of the overheat protector 622 is KSD301, sold by Shundezhongbao manufacturers; the middle pipe heating pipe 623 is a double-head heating pipe and is sold by a safe electric heating factory; the UV germicidal lamp 632 model is single ended four needles, sold by Shiwanhua; the stirring motor 75 is a 60-speed reduction motor, and is sold by Union motor manufacturers; the type of the aluminum foil heating sheet 8 is ST, and the aluminum foil heating sheet is sold by starlight electric heating factories; the type of the key board 9 is FD-011A, which is sold by Dongsheng electrical equipment manufacturers; the controller is FD 011K, sold by Dongsheng electrical equipment manufacturers;
further, the utility model discloses a method for realizing multifunctional kitchen garbage disposer, including following steps:
firstly, kitchen garbage enters a crusher 2 through a kitchen stainless steel water tank 1 to be crushed, water is needed to be flushed during crushing, and the crushed kitchen garbage is driven by water flow to enter a solid-liquid separation bin 53;
secondly, the crushed kitchen waste enters the solid-liquid separation bin 53 through the inlet pipe 56, the scraper frame 52 rotates anticlockwise under the action of the scraper motor 55 so as to drive the scraper 59 to rotate anticlockwise, the solid kitchen waste enters the reaction barrel 7 from the solid outlet 54, and the liquid kitchen waste flows into a sewer from the liquid outlet 57 after being filtered by the solid-liquid separation filter screen 58;
thirdly, stirring the solid kitchen garbage in the stirring barrel 71 through a stirring rod 73 and stirring blades 79, uniformly mixing the solid kitchen garbage with microorganisms, and performing biological fermentation to obtain an organic fertilizer;
and fourthly, the gas with peculiar smell and harmful substances generated in the fermentation process enters the purifying device 6, is purified by the purifying device 6 and then is discharged.
In conclusion, the kitchen garbage is crushed by the crusher, so that microorganisms can be decomposed more quickly, and the time for converting the microorganisms into organic fertilizers is shorter; the kitchen waste crushed by the utility model enters the reaction barrel after passing through the solid-liquid separation bin, so that the water content of the kitchen waste entering the reaction barrel is less, and the decomposition speed of the kitchen waste by the microorganism is accelerated; the utility model can reduce the pollution to water quality and reduce the risk of blocking the sewer pipe; the utility model discloses can become the organic fertilizer that the plant absorbs with kitchen rubbish and carry out recycle.
